"The Studios of Paris: Capital of Art in the Late Nineteenth Century" by J Milner is a textbook published by Yale University Press in 1990. This trade paperback book, measuring 11 inches in length, 9.5 inches in width, and 0.8 inches in height, explores the European art scene in the late 19th century with a focus on the history of the Parisian art studios. Written in English, this 252-page book is suitable for adult learners and university students studying art history, offering a comprehensive examination of the artistic landscape during that period."
